What is Frostpunk 2 Cheat Engine and How Does It Work?
Frostpunk 2 cheat engine refers to the use of Cheat Engine software—a powerful open-source memory scanner and debugger—to modify values within the Frostpunk 2 game while it’s running. Cheat Engine works by scanning your computer’s RAM to locate specific values associated with game resources like heat stamps, resources, population, and other crucial gameplay elements. Once these memory addresses are identified, players can modify them to adjust their in-game advantages or test different scenarios without playing through the standard progression system. The tool essentially allows you to peek behind the curtain of the game’s programming and make real-time adjustments to how the game operates.
The software functions through a process called memory editing, where it reads and writes data to specific locations in your computer’s memory where Frostpunk 2 stores its active game state. When you have 1000 units of coal in your storage, for example, that number exists as a value in a specific memory address. Cheat Engine for Frostpunk 2 scans through thousands or millions of these addresses to find the exact location where your coal count is stored, then allows you to change that value to whatever you desire. This process requires some technical understanding but has been streamlined over the years to be accessible to players with minimal programming knowledge.
Understanding Memory Scanning Techniques
Memory scanning is the foundation of how Cheat Engine operates within Frostpunk 2’s game environment. The process begins with an initial scan where you input a known value from your game—such as your current amount of heat stamps or wood. Cheat Engine then searches through all memory addresses to find locations storing that exact value. Since thousands of addresses might contain the same number, you need to perform subsequent scans.
You change the value in-game (by spending or gaining resources) and scan again for the new value. By repeating this process several times, you narrow down the possibilities until you’ve isolated the specific memory address that controls that particular resource. This technique, known as comparative scanning, is essential for successfully implementing Frostpunk 2 cheat engine modifications.
Advanced users can employ pointer scanning, which takes memory modification to another level by finding static addresses that point to dynamic memory locations. Since games like Frostpunk 2 often load resources into different memory locations each time you launch the game, direct address modification only works for that specific session. Pointer scanning identifies permanent addresses that always lead to the resource values you want to modify, regardless of how many times you restart the game. This creates reusable cheat tables that can be shared with other players and used across multiple gaming sessions without needing to perform fresh scans each time.
The Technical Architecture Behind Game Modifications
Understanding how Frostpunk 2 stores and processes data helps explain why cheat engine modifications are possible. The game uses various data structures to manage resources, including integers for countable items, floating-point numbers for percentages and ratios, and complex arrays for managing multiple related values. Resources in Frostpunk 2 are typically stored as 4-byte integer values, which means they can range from -2,147,483,648 to 2,147,483,647. When you’re searching for resource values using cheat engine, selecting “4 bytes” as your value type is usually the most effective approach. However, some values like temperature modifiers or efficiency percentages might be stored as floating-point numbers (decimals), requiring different scanning parameters.
The game engine processes these values through various calculations and checks during gameplay. When you modify a value using Frostpunk 2 cheat engine, you’re essentially bypassing the game’s intended calculation processes. For instance, when you harvest resources normally, the game runs through checks for worker efficiency, building functionality, and environmental conditions before determining how much you gain. By directly editing the final stored value, you skip all these intermediate steps. This is why cheat engine modifications can sometimes cause unexpected behavior—the game’s other systems might not properly account for values that appear “magically” without going through normal gameplay channels.

Initial Setup and Game Process Selection
After launching Cheat Engine, you’ll see the main interface with various buttons and options. The first critical step is attaching Cheat Engine to the Frostpunk 2 game process. Click the computer icon in the top-left corner (often depicted as a monitor with a magnifying glass) to open the process list. Scroll through the list of running applications until you find the Frostpunk 2 executable—it will typically be named something like “Frostpunk2.exe” or similar, depending on your game version. Select this process and click “Open” to attach Cheat Engine to the game. You should now see the process name displayed in Cheat Engine’s title bar, confirming the connection has been established successfully.
Once connected, familiarize yourself with the main interface elements. The value input field at the top is where you’ll enter the numbers you want to search for in the game’s memory. The scan type dropdown lets you choose between different search methods like “Exact Value,” “Bigger than,” “Smaller than,” or “Unknown initial value.
” For most Frostpunk 2 cheat engine applications, you’ll start with “Exact Value” searches. The value type dropdown (defaulting to “4 bytes” for most game resources) determines how Cheat Engine interprets the data it finds. The large list on the left side will populate with memory addresses as you perform scans, while the bottom section shows addresses you’ve added to your cheat table for active monitoring or modification.
Finding and Modifying Resource Values
Let’s walk through a practical example of modifying heat stamps, one of Frostpunk 2’s primary currencies. First, note your current heat stamp count in the game—let’s say you have 1,247 heat stamps. Enter “1247” in the value field in Cheat Engine, ensure “4 bytes” is selected as the value type, and click “First Scan.” Cheat Engine will search through memory and likely return thousands of addresses containing that value.
Don’t be discouraged by the large number—this is normal. Now return to Frostpunk 2 and change your heat stamp count by spending some or gaining more through gameplay. If your count changes to 1,189, return to Cheat Engine, enter “1189,” and click “Next Scan.” The address list should shrink dramatically.
Repeat this process of changing the value in-game and scanning for the new value until you’re left with just a handful of addresses—ideally one or two. These remaining addresses are highly likely to be the actual memory location controlling your heat stamps. Double-click on the address to add it to your cheat table (the bottom section). Once added, you can double-click the value in the cheat table to change it to whatever amount you want. Enter your desired heat stamp count, press enter, and return to the game. Your heat stamp count should immediately reflect the new value. This same process works for virtually any countable resource in Frostpunk 2, including materials, workforce, research points, and more.

Troubleshooting Common Issues with Cheat Engine Modifications
Even experienced users encounter problems when using Frostpunk 2 cheat engine modifications. Understanding common issues and their solutions helps you troubleshoot effectively when things don’t work as expected. The most frequent problem is failing to find the correct memory address during scanning. This typically occurs because the value you’re searching for is stored in a different format than you specified—perhaps it’s a 2-byte integer instead of 4-byte, or a floating-point value instead of an integer.
When standard scans fail, experiment with different value types. Additionally, some values are displayed differently in the game interface than how they’re actually stored in memory. A percentage shown as “75%” might be stored as “0.75” or “75.00” or even “7500” (representing 75.00 with two decimal places), requiring different search approaches.
Addressing Value Type Mismatches
When your scans aren’t narrowing down to a manageable number of addresses, the value type setting is likely incorrect. Try searching as “Float” or “Double” instead of “4 bytes” for percentages, multipliers, and efficiency ratings. For population numbers or other counts that seem impossible to isolate as 4-byte integers, try “2 bytes” instead. Some games use unconventional number storage methods—negative numbers to represent positive values, inverted scales where higher numbers represent less of something, or offset values where the displayed number plus or minus a constant equals the stored number. These quirks require experimentation and patience to discover. The Cheat Engine forums and game-specific communities often document these unusual storage methods for popular games like Frostpunk 2.
Array of Byte searching represents an advanced troubleshooting technique when standard value searches fail completely. Some game values are stored as part of larger data structures that aren’t easily isolated through simple value scanning. Array of Byte searches let you scan for patterns of hexadecimal values that remain constant around the value you want to modify. This requires converting the value to hexadecimal format and understanding how data is structured in memory—definitely an advanced technique. However, for persistent scanning problems with Frostpunk 2 cheat engine, this approach can break through when simpler methods fail. Dealing with Crashes and Corrupted Saves
Game crashes after implementing modifications usually result from setting values to unrealistic extremes or modifying addresses incorrectly. Frostpunk 2’s game engine includes various sanity checks and maximum values for different resources and statistics. Exceeding these limits can cause calculation overflows, infinite loops, or other errors that crash the game. When experimenting with modifications, start with modest values before pushing to extremes. Instead of immediately setting resources to 999,999,999, try 100,000 first. If that works smoothly, gradually increase to find the practical limits. Some game values have hard-coded maximums—trying to exceed them automatically resets them to zero or causes immediate crashes.

Managing Anti-Cheat and Game Protection Systems
While Frostpunk 2 doesn’t include aggressive anti-cheat systems like competitive multiplayer games, some protection mechanisms may interfere with cheat engine functionality. The game might use basic memory protection that prevents external programs from reading or modifying its memory space. If Cheat Engine can’t attach to the Frostpunk 2 process or scans complete instantly without finding any values, memory protection is likely active. Running both Cheat Engine and the game as administrator (right-click the executable and select “Run as administrator”) often resolves permission-based attachment issues. Additionally, ensure your antivirus isn’t quarantining Cheat Engine or blocking its memory access capabilities.
Steam overlay and other game platform features can sometimes interfere with cheat engine operations. If you’re experiencing unusual behavior, try disabling the Steam overlay for Frostpunk 2 through Steam’s game properties. Similarly, close any unnecessary background applications, especially recording software, performance monitors, or other tools that might conflict with Cheat Engine’s memory access. Some users report better stability running Frostpunk 2 in windowed or borderless windowed mode rather than fullscreen when using cheat engine, as this reduces conflicts with Windows’ memory management and makes switching between applications more reliable. Memory Pointer Manipulation and Permanent Modifications
Understanding and manipulating memory pointers enables permanent Frostpunk 2 cheat engine modifications that persist across game sessions without requiring fresh scans. As mentioned earlier, games load resources into different memory locations each time they launch. Direct address modifications only work for that specific session. Pointers solve this by identifying static memory addresses that always point to the dynamic locations where specific values are stored. Once you’ve identified these pointer addresses through pointer scans, you can create cheat table entries that automatically work every time you launch the game without additional scanning.
Pointer scanning requires patience and technical understanding but creates extremely robust modifications. The process involves performing standard value scans to identify addresses, then using Cheat Engine’s pointer scan functionality to find all pointer paths leading to those addresses. You might find dozens or hundreds of potential pointer chains. The challenge is identifying which pointers reliably work across game restarts. This typically requires launching the game multiple times, checking which pointer addresses still correctly resolve to your target values. Eventually, you isolate stable pointers that remain consistent regardless of how memory is allocated during startup. Once found, these pointers enable one-click modifications that work permanently.
